Tony
        I have the instructions for an old Allison Opto-Electric Ignition
system but there is no Purple wire; just red and black going to the coil
with the case screws as ground.   You must have a newer unit.

        A Google search indicates that Allison is now Crane.   You might
want to email Crane to see if they have a wire diagram for your model.  I
took a quick look on their web site and I only saw red, yellow and black
wires.   Red and yellow wires go to the coil, black wire is ground.

Generally; 
Black wire is ground
Red wire goes to + side of coil, which leaves your purple wire going to the
- side of the coil; but that is just my guess.  I would contact Crane first.

Personally, I would remove the Allison unit and install a Pertronix set up.

Hi all

    I have a Series 5 Alpine I am restoring and it is fitted with an older
style Allison XR700 Ignition Module. I cannot find a wiring diagragm to suit
the wiring code. It has 3 wires Red, Purple & Black coming from it I assume
2 go to the coil and 1 to earth.

Any ideas
